Brookfield Asset Management Ltd. (NYSE:BAM - Get Free Report) TSE: BAM.A shares reached a new 52-week high on Wednesday . The stock traded as high as $63.79 and last traded at $63.39, with a volume of 268921 shares changing hands. The stock had previously closed at $61.54.
Wall Street Analyst Weigh In
Several research analysts recently weighed in on BAM shares. Bank of America upgraded shares of Brookfield Asset Management from a "neutral" rating to a "buy" rating and set a $65.00 price target on the stock in a report on Thursday, April 10th. Morgan Stanley raised their price objective on shares of Brookfield Asset Management from $50.00 to $54.00 and gave the company an "equal weight" rating in a research note on Friday, May 16th. TD Securities boosted their target price on shares of Brookfield Asset Management from $66.00 to $75.00 and gave the company a "buy" rating in a research report on Monday, July 28th. Wells Fargo & Company lifted their price target on shares of Brookfield Asset Management from $55.00 to $57.00 and gave the company an "underweight" rating in a report on Friday, July 11th. Finally, Jefferies Financial Group lowered their target price on shares of Brookfield Asset Management from $52.00 to $46.00 and set a "hold" rating on the stock in a report on Tuesday, April 8th. Two investment analysts have rated the stock with a sell rating, six have assigned a hold rating, ten have issued a buy rating and two have assigned a strong buy rating to the company's stock. According to MarketBeat, the stock currently has an average rating of "Moderate Buy" and a consensus target price of $62.06.

Brookfield Asset Management Trading Up 1.7%
The company has a fifty day simple moving average of $57.45 and a 200-day simple moving average of $54.94. The stock has a market cap of $102.46 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 44.37, a P/E/G ratio of 2.36 and a beta of 1.44. The company has a current ratio of 1.31, a quick ratio of 1.31 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.07.
Brookfield Asset Management (NYSE:BAM - Get Free Report) TSE: BAM.A last released its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, May 6th. The financial services provider reported $0.40 earnings per share for the quarter, meeting the consensus estimate of $0.40. Brookfield Asset Management had a return on equity of 52.70% and a net margin of 55.26%. The business had revenue of $1.04 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ts' expectations of $1.29 billion. On average, research analysts forecast that Brookfield Asset Management Ltd. will post 1.7 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Brookfield Asset Management Ltd. is a real estate investment firm specializing in alternative asset management services. Its renewable power and transition business includes the operates in the hydroelectric, wind, solar, distributed generation, and sustainable solution sector. The company's infrastructure business engages in the utilities, transport, midstream, and data infrastructure sectors.
